You need to be 21yrs of age or older with a valid Class C cdl drivers license. Class C is a written exam upgrade to your license. You also need to have 3 clean years, no moving violations no outstanding tickets or summons. Maggies as all Access A Ride carriers offer paid training. Then 3month probationary period.
